How does the flickering flame effect impact battery life?
The flickering flame effect in Solar Skull Torch Lights utilizes a sequenced LED array that consumes less power than a steady-state high-lumen bulb, extending the nightly run-time. The conventional wisdom says that more LEDs equate to faster battery drain, but this ignores the pulse-width modulation typically used to create the "flicker." By rapidly cycling the power to individual diodes rather than keeping a single filament illuminated, these torches manage to simulate fire while maintaining a lower average current draw. Run the math: a standard 600mAh Ni-MH battery can sustain these specific flickering patterns for approximately 6 to 8 hours, whereas a constant-on white LED of the same perceived brightness would likely fail two hours earlier. Can these torches survive heavy rain and snow?

Photo by JUNLIN ZOU on Pexels
Solar Skull Torch Lights are engineered with internal gaskets designed to prevent moisture ingress into the battery compartment and LED housing during typical vertical rainfall. Here's the part nobody talks about: waterproof ratings are often tested in controlled environments with fresh water, meaning salt-heavy coastal air or acidic rain can degrade the exterior skull casing faster than the internal electronics. The structural design relies on a tapered stake and a sealed top-mounted solar panel to shed water away from the sensitive components. While they are marketed as all-weather, physical placement matters more than the rating itself; a torch placed in a low-lying area prone to pooling will face hydrostatic pressure that the seals were never designed to withstand. Q: What is the specific waterproof rating of these torches? A: Solar Skull Torch Lights are typically built to an IP65 standard, which means they are protected against dust ingress and low-pressure water jets from any direction. This rating ensures they remain functional during heavy rainstorms but does not allow for full submersion in garden ponds or flooding.
Q: How many LEDs are used to create the flame effect? A: Each unit contains between 12 and 33 individual LED beads that fire in a randomized sequence to mimic natural combustion. This specific density is calibrated to balance visual realism with the energy constraints of a small-format solar collector.
Q: Do the skull casings yellow or crack in direct UV light? A: The casings are manufactured from high-impact ABS plastic treated with a UV-inhibitor to prevent the material from becoming brittle. Under standard conditions, the structural integrity of the Solar Skull Torch Lights is designed to last for at least two full seasons of outdoor exposure before visible degradation occurs.
